-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
安徽科技学院《单片机原理与应用》复习资料
单片机原理与应用第一章单片机基础知识一、什么是单片机答:单片机的全称是单片微型计算机,它是指在一块半导体芯片上,集成了微处理器、存储器、输入\输出接口、定时器\计数器以及中断系统等功能部件,构成了一台完整的微型计算机。二、单片机与微型计算机的关系1、计算机经历了从电子管、晶体管、集成电路、大规模集成电路四代的演变。2、随着大规模集成电路技术的进一步发展。微型计算机向两个主要方向发展:①向高速度、高性能、大容量的高档微型计算机及其系列化方向发展。②向稳定性、小而廉、能适应各种控制领域需要的单片机方向发展。三、计算机的基本结构1、计算机的基本结构,它是由运算器、控制器、存储器、输入和输出设备五大部分组成。2、运算器是计算机处理信息的主要部件3、控制器是产生一系列控制命令,控制计算机各部件自动地、协调地工作。4、输入设备是用来输入程序与数据,常用的输入设备有键盘、鼠标、光电输入机、扫描仪。5、输出设备是将计算机的处理结果用数字、图形等形式表示出来。常用的输出设备有数码管、打印机。6、由于运算器、控制器是计算机处理信息的关键部件,所常将它们合称为中央处理器。7、运算器、控制器、存储器这三部分称为计算机主机。8、输入、输出设备称为计算机的外围设备(外设)。四、微型计算机的结构1、微型处理器是微型计算机的核心,它通常包括算术逻辑部件、工作寄存组、控制部件。(微处理器)微型计算机中的几个常用术语(存储器)1、位(bit):是计算机所能表示的最小的数据单位,即1位二进制数,它有两种状态:0和1。字节(Byte):一个连续的8位二进制数称为一个字节,即1Byte=8bit。3、字(word):通常把16位二进制数称为一个字,32位二进制数称为一个双字。4、字长 CPU一次能够处理二进制信息的位数称为字长,通常也指CPU与输入\输出设备或内存储器之间一次传送二进制数据的位数。【注】计算机的字长与处理能力和计算机精度有关。字长越长。计算精度越高。处理能力越强,但计算机的结构也变得更加复杂。总线总线定义:是在微型计算机各芯片之间或芯片内部各部件之间传输信息的一组公共通信线。根据传递信息种类,总线可以分为地址总线、数据总线、控制总线。复用总线:计算机用一组总线分时传送地址和数据信息,称为地址\数据分时复用总线。单总线结构:在微处理器内部往往只使用一组总线,称为单总线结构。指令控制计算机进行操作的命令称为指令。指令分成操作码和操作数两大部分,操作数:表示参加运算的数据或数据所在的地址。操作码:表示该指令执行何种操作。数制的概念1、一个数值可以用不同的数表示。2、二进制数用B表示。2、十六进制数用H表示。3、十进制数用D表示。【注】1、其中H、D、B均为标识符。2、计数制中所具有的数码的个数称为数制的基,如十进制数的基为十;计数制中的每一位所具有的值称为权,十进制数的权是以十为底的幂,二进制数的权是以二为底的幂。十进制数用D表示,其中D可以不用写出,即不带标识符的数是十进制数。还可以在右下方加一个小数字说明(896)10。与计算机有关的数制1、十进制数特点:有10个不同的数字符号:0、1、2、3、…、9.逢十进一,即各位的权是以十为底的幂。【例子】398.6=3*102+9*101+8*100+6*10—1。2、二进制数特点有两个不同的数字符号:0,1.逢二进一,即各位的权是以2为底的幂。【例子】111.1B=1*22+1*21+1*20+1*2—1。3、十六进制数特点有16个不同的数字符号:0、1、2、3、…、9、A、B、C、D、E、F。逢十六进位。即各位的权是以十六为底的幂。【例子】18AF.CBH=1*163+1*162+A*161+F*160+C*16-1+B*16-2。数制转换1)二进制、十六进制数转换为十进制数转换方法:将二进制数或十六进制数写成按权展开式,然后各项相加,则得到相应的十进制数。【例子】二进制数转换成十进制10101.1011B=1*104+1*102+1*100+1*10-1+1*10-3+1*10-4。十六进制转换为十进制0F3DH=F*162+3*161+D*160=15*256+3*16+13*1=3901D2)十进制数转换二进制数转换方法整数部分采用处二取余法,小数部分采用乘二取整法。【例子】将十进制数19.625转换成对应的二进制数 2 19 ……………11 2 9 ………… 1 2 4 …………0(余数) 从下往上写 2 2 ………0 2 1 ………1 0整数部分转换结果为10011 0.625 * 2 1.250…… 1
原创力文档


文档评论(0)